Allie Velasco wants to be a trailblazer. A trendsetter. A winner. Everyone in her family is special in some way—her younger sister is a rising TV star; her brother is a soccer prodigy; her great-grandfather is a Congressional Medal of Honor winner. With a family like this, Allie knows she has to make her mark or risk being left behind. When a prestigious school contest is announced, Allie has the perfect opportunity. There's just one small snag: her biggest competition is also her ex-best friend, Sara. Can Allie take top prize and win back a friend, or is she destined to lose it all?
